Anyone who owns an electric guitar should own one of these. It's a versatile little amp, great for practicing. It has excellent sound for a solid state amp across a range of settings and effects. It's the best sounding "very small", solid state amp I've come across. It's got a headphone jack for quiet practice, and the aux in jack can be used to play along with tracks from an iPod or other music player. It will run a long time on AA batteries, so you can take it out busking. It's loud enough to play a small venue, as long as you don't need to get over a drum kit, so if you need something you can readily get on and off stage for an open mic night performance, this is it. Backyard wedding gig? This will allow you to set up anywhere, powered by batteries. Need a backup amp for larger gigs? This takes up almost no space, and you can mic it into the house PA in a pinch. This amp's also extremely durable. If you find one used, get it. If the power supply is missing, don't despair. Roland=Boss, and a standard Boss power supply will work with this little amp.Read full review
